2 new widgets for Mac OS X.4 are available for download here:

http://developer.servoy.com/generic.jsp?taxonomy_id=486

The forum widget allows you to see the most recent threads on the Servoy Forum and search directly through the forum.

The Headless Client Example Widget connects to a Servoy solution and displays data out of that solution inside a widget. You can easily take this widget as a starting point to display data of any Servoy solution directly in a widget.

We are pleased to announce the immediate availability of our popular Servoy Forum and ServoyWorld Countdown widgets for Yahoo Widgets and Apple Dashboard.

Mac OS X Dashboard widgets are currently available for the Macintosh (Mac OS X 10.4 and higher) only; the Yahoo widgets are cross-platform, so they can be installed on either the Macintosh (Mac OS X 10.3 and higher) or Windows (Windows XP/Windows 2000 or higher) platforms.
